1. What is the topic of your lesson?


The topic of my lesson is kindness and acceptance.

2. Why are you teaching this lesson? What is your rationale for teaching it?
My rationale for teaching this lesson is that it relates to the kindergarten standard
of learning to be good citizens.
3. What is your Teaching Behavior Focus? Why did you choose this?
My focus is to use appropriate language when discussing kindness and respect
with the class. I chose this because I want to improve my vocabulary to be age
appropriate.
4. Why did you design your instruction in this lesson the way that you did? Why did
you choose this way of teaching the lesson (e.g., Was the idea from a methods
course? From your mentor teacher? Another source?)
I designed my lesson to be this way because I wanted the students to be
engaged through reading the book, but also take away a lesson that can be
applied both inside and outside of the classroom as well.
5. As you are thinking through this lesson, what do you believe will be the most
challenging part of this lesson for you when you teach it? Why?
I believe the most challenging part of this lesson will be to ensure that the
students are staying on task and focusing on the content of the lesson.
6. How will you know if your learning outcomes for the students are met
successfully?
I will know that this lesson was successful if the class can discuss the books
meaning and establish things that they hope to do to create a kind environment
in their classroom.
7. How will your classroom management support the learning outcomes?
My classroom management will support the learning outcomes by asking
questions about the reading to make sure they stay engaged in the story, as well
as following up with ideas mentioned in the book after we have finished reading
it.
8. List 1-3 areas which you would like for your observer to pay particular attention.
Why do you want your observer to focus on these areas?
Vocabulary and Classroom Management. I want feedback in these two areas
because I have realized how vital they are to becoming a successful teacher
through this field placement and it is something I want to be very strong in.
